The untitled fourth studio album by the English rock band Led Zeppelin, commonly known as Led Zeppelin IV, was released on 8 November 1971 by Atlantic Records. It was produced by guitarist Jimmy Page and recorded between December 1970 and February 1971, mostly in the country house Headley Grange.

Each of the tracks spirals of in it’s own direction with the gentle rock of ‘Going to California’, the nasty blues of ‘Black Dog’ or the epic ‘Stairway to Heaven’, but somehow Robert Plant, Jimmy Page, John Bonham and John Paul Jones tie the record together in a way only Led Zeppelin can.
